首页 > 科技 >

🌟Python中的 reshape 方法 | NumPy 库深度解读💪

发布时间:2025-03-27 19:48:02来源:

在 Python 编程中,NumPy 是一个极为强大的科学计算库,而 `reshape` 方法则是其中最常用且实用的功能之一!🚀 它能够轻松改变数组的形状,为数据处理提供了极大的灵活性。例如,将一维数组转换为二维或多维数组,以适应不同的算法需求。

首先,了解 `reshape` 的基本语法:`array.reshape(new_shape)`。它允许你定义新的维度,比如 `(2, 3)` 表示两行三列。值得注意的是,新形状的元素总数必须与原数组保持一致,否则会报错哦!💡

此外,当你需要动态调整形状时,可以使用 `-1` 参数,NumPy 会自动推算出合适的值。例如,`array.reshape(2, -1)` 将根据数据长度自动匹配列数。🎯

无论是数据分析、图像处理还是机器学习建模,`reshape` 都是不可或缺的工具。熟练掌握这一技巧,能显著提升代码效率和可读性。快去试试吧,让数据在你的手中焕然一新!✨

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。